How can companies measure the effectiveness of gamification in reinforcing CX guidelines and improving employee engagement in the long term?
Companies can measure the effectiveness of gamification in reinforcing CX guidelines and improving employee engagement by tracking key performance indicators such as customer satisfaction scores, employee retention rates, and productivity levels. They can also conduct surveys and feedback sessions to gather insights from both customers and employees on their experiences with gamification. Additionally, companies can analyze data on game participation, completion rates, and overall engagement levels to assess the impact of gamification on CX and employee engagement in the long term. Regularly reviewing and adjusting gamification strategies based on these metrics can help companies continuously improve the effectiveness of their gamification initiatives.
